WebFeb 4, 2024 · How Olympic legend Mark Spitz keeps his AFib in check Aging puts us at risk for AFib, but former athletes like Spitz are at higher risk. Mark Spitz won nine Olympic gold medals for swimming, including seven in 1972, when he also set a new world record in each event.
